In-store displays for First Choice included window greenery and rainforest animals alongside typical celebrity items like sunglasses, lipstick and tiaras.
The acetate window prints and posters were designed by Gratterpalm and were printed on bezier's Thieme four- and five-colour screen presses and sent to stores nationwide.
"Store media was crucial," said First Choice Retail head of marketing Ian Scott. "We wanted to make sure customers made the connection on the high street between the show and First Choice, which has sponsored the programme for four years."
